Trivia

  • Early in the design of No Fear, a drain post (between the flippers) was considered. Therefore the playfield was manufactured with the hole for the post already drilled, but without the post installed (plugged instead). The earliest sample games even shipped with the post as part of the supplied spare parts, in case the decision was made to install it after more real-world play data was gathered. That decision was not made and No Fear went into production with a plug instead of a post.

Video mode

With a motorcycle, make high jumps over various hills, trying to catch points floating up in the air.
